Invoicing construction projects requires a lot of planning, detail, and communication from all parties. Mismanaging invoices can be detrimental to contractor’s financial position — and the overall success of a project. Keeping organized records of your costs will save time on a project in more ways than one. For instance, coding all costs correctly according to the project can make the invoicing process much more efficient. Additionally, keeping organized records of correct coding can help solve disputes between owners, contractors, and subcontractors.

A construction invoice also serves as an essential document for accounting, tax, and legal purposes, both for the issuer and the recipient. Professionals can generate invoices using invoicing software or manually.
These invoices also keep record of materials delivered and smaller jobs completed. For instance, a supplier will send an invoice to a GC What is bookkeeping after completing a delivery. A GC will send a payment application to the owner along other documentation providing evidence to the labor, time, and materials they are billing for. Invoices are generally straightforward bills from vendors or contractors on smaller jobs or residential projects. Progress billing, also known as milestone billing, pays contractors based on the percentage of work they have completed. This method of invoicing is popular with both owners and contractors.
